N915 AWM is a 1995 Rover Mini in Blue with a 1,275cc petrol engine. This vehicle has been through 18 MOT tests with a personal pass rate of 72.2%.
Across all 1995 Rover Mini models, the average MOT pass rate is 65.5% with a typical mileage of 51,922 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Rover Mini fails its MOT is subframe mounting prescribed area is excessively corroded, accounting for 32,036 recorded failures. If you're considering buying N915 AWM, it's worth having these areas checked by a mechanic before committing.
The Rover Mini typically stays on UK roads for around 47 years. At 31 years old, this Rover Mini is well into its expected lifespan but still has years ahead.
